OrionStar LuckiBot — CE-Certified AI Service Robot for European Hospitality
European restaurants, hotels, and hospitality venues are embracing service automation to address labour market pressures while elevating the guest experience. The OrionStar LuckiBot is CE-certified and GDPR-ready — delivering food, bussing tables, and greeting guests autonomously across restaurants in Germany, France, the UK, the Netherlands, and beyond.
LuckiBot's advanced LiDAR SLAM navigation maps your dining room with centimetre precision, navigating safely around guests and dynamic furniture arrangements typical of European restaurant layouts.
Technical Specifications
| Specification | Value |
|---|---|
| Functions | Food Delivery, Table Bussing, Guest Greeting |
| Navigation | LiDAR SLAM — no floor modifications |
| Tray Levels | Multi-tier (up to 3 levels) |
| Certification | CE Marked (EU Machinery & EMC Directives) |
| Data Compliance | GDPR-ready; no guest personal data collected |
| Speed | Up to 1.2 m/s (adjustable) |
| Interface Languages | EN, DE, FR, NL, ES, IT (and more) |
| Deployment | EU-wide; UK & Switzerland available |

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Is the LuckiBot certified for use in European restaurants and hotels?
A: Yes. LuckiBot carries CE marking, confirming compliance with applicable EU directives including the Machinery Directive (2006/42/EC), making it legal and safe for commercial hospitality deployment across EU member states.
Q: Does it comply with GDPR?
A: LuckiBot does not collect personal data from guests. The cloud management platform is designed for GDPR compliance, with EU data residency options available for operators who require it.
Q: Can LuckiBot handle narrow European restaurant layouts?
A: Yes. LuckiBot is designed to navigate spaces as narrow as 70 cm clearance. Its real-time obstacle avoidance adapts to tightly spaced tables typical of Parisian bistros, London gastropubs, and Italian trattorias.
